首頁  >  文章  >  web前端  >  如何清除 JavaScript 快取並強制瀏覽器刷新?

如何清除 JavaScript 快取並強制瀏覽器刷新?

DDD
DDD原創
2024-10-31 03:44:01917瀏覽

How to Clear the JavaScript Cache and Force a Browser Refresh?

清除JavaScript 中的快取:強制瀏覽器刷新

要解決快取JavaScript 程式碼的問題,必須了解如何強制刷新它在瀏覽器中。雖然瀏覽器通常透過快取資源來優化用戶體驗,但這可能會導致過時的程式碼更新無法顯示。

解決方案:

清除瀏覽器快取的最佳解決方案特定頁則呼叫window.location.reload(true)方法。此命令強制瀏覽器忽略快取的項目並檢索頁面資源的新副本,包括 JavaScript。

其他注意事項:

儘管 window.location.reload(true ) 有效地刷新當前頁面的緩存,但不會清除 gesamte 快取。為了獲得更全面的快取清除解決方案,建議將版本控制合併到 JavaScript 資源的路徑或檔案名稱中。透過更新版本號,提示瀏覽器檢索最新版本,不依賴快取。

注意:

reload() 函數的無參數版本為Firefox 主要支援的非標準方法。因此,建議使用 reload(true) 以獲得更廣泛的兼容性。

以上是如何清除 JavaScript 快取並強制瀏覽器刷新?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n